The travel time between Southend East and Meadowhall by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 4hrs 31 mins & the fastest journey takes 4hrs 5 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Southend East to Meadowhall is 4hrs 5 mins.
Train ticket prices from Southend East to Meadowhall can start from as little as £22.70 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Southend East and Meadowhall v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 32 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 04:31,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:45.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Southend East & Meadowhall. However, there are 32 possible journeys which require a change.
Grand Central, First TransPennine Express, c2c, London North Eastern Railway, Northern Rail, East Midlands Railway and First Hull Trains are the main train operating companies running services between Southend East and Meadowhall.

Southend East station is equipped with an array of facilities to cater to your travel needs. Whether you're purchasing your ticket or collecting one bought online, services are available with convenient opening hours. From Monday to Friday, the ticket office opens from 05:15 to 18:00, while weekend hours vary slightly. You can find accessible ticket machines and a helpful induction loop, ensuring a smooth experience for everyone.
For those seeking assistance, helpful station staff are available Monday through Friday from 06:00 to 19:30. You can find customer help points and detailed screens with departure information along with regular announcements to keep you up to date. The installation of CCTV across the station ensures a safe environment for all passengers.
Accessibility options are robust, particularly with step-free access available to London-bound platform 1. However, some areas may have limitations. There are accessible ticket machines and toilets on-site, along with ramp access for those boarding trains. Although there's no wheelchair availability or accessible taxis at the station, these facilities are compensated for by attentive staff willing to offer support.
For comfort while waiting, you have access to cozy waiting rooms located on platform 1, open until late evening during weekdays. Refreshments are available, although food and drink options might be limited, with no shops or ATMs present. Thanks to public Wi-Fi, passengers can stay connected while they wait.
Transportation links around Southend East station are well organized to facilitate your onward journey. Bus services are easily accessed via nearby bus stops on Southchurch Road, with practical rail replacement options also provided. For those planning to explore further afield, detailed travel posters are available. Although accessible taxis aren't directly available at the station, alternative arrangements can be made.

Located in the heart of Sheffield's bustling shopping district, Meadowhall train station is a key transport hub for the region, offering an array of services and travel options to make your journey straightforward and convenient. Whether you're a local commuter or a visitor looking to explore this vibrant part of South Yorkshire, Meadowhall makes for a pivotal starting point. Set adjacent to the Meadowhall Shopping Centre, one of the largest retail venues in the UK, it's an ideal stop for travelers who want to combine retail therapy with their rail journey.
At Meadowhall station, ticket purchasing is hassle-free with the ticket office open from 06:00 to 20:15 on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ly reduced hours on Sundays from 09:00 to 19:30. For those who prefer self-service options, ticket machines are available and accessible, accepting both cash and cards. The station also supports smartcard purchases, although validators are not available.
When it comes to amenities, the station ensures that passengers with mobility challenges are well-catered for, offering step-free access throughout. This accessibility extends to the availability of accessible toilets and seating areas. However, for those needing extra assistance, staff help is on hand to ensure every passenger's needs are met.
While there are no luggage storage facilities or CCTV, rest assured that essential services like toilets and customer help points are present. If you're feeling peckish or in need of a quick shopping spree, refreshment facilities and shops are conveniently located within the station.
One of Meadowhall's strengths is its seamless connections to various forms of transport. The station is a critical node with bus services readily accessible at the adjacent bus station. You can hop onto the Supertram, providing ease of travel across Sheffield, including to Sheffield Stadium. Taxis are bookable via Northern Railway's service, ensuring a smooth journey to your onward destination.
If you fancy cycling, bike hire options are available, though not directly at the station, which supports an eco-friendly travel lifestyle amidst the urban setting.
